Discovering the Potential of Digital Twins in Smart Buildings
Smart buildings are rapidly adapting to meet the demands of a interconnected world. At the heart of this revolution lie digital twins—virtual representations of physical assets that facilitate unprecedented insights and control. These dynamic models simulate the real-world functionality of buildings in intricate detail, offering a robust platform for optimization. By leveraging data from various sensors and systems, digital twins can identify potential issues before they deteriorate, leading to enhanced efficiency, reduced costs, and optimal occupant comfort.

Bridging the Gap: Digital Twins and IoT in Smart Building Management
Smart building management employs the power of digital twins and the Internet of Things (IoT) to enhance operational efficiency and create a more sustainable built environment. By integrating real-time data from sensors, actuators, and building systems into a virtual replica of the physical structure, digital twins provide valuable observations for informed decision-making. This allows building managers to proactively address issues, predict potential malfunctions, and deploy measures to improve energy consumption, occupant comfort, and overall building performance.
